Houston native Brooke Valentine’s debut, Chain Letter , was one of the greatest R& B albums of the oughts...or of all time, for that matter. From the loping, burping strut of “Pass Us By,” to the tongue-in-cheek goth-funk of “I Want You Dead” to the aching, breathy heartbreak of “Laugh Til I Cry,” Chain Letter was all over the place stylistically, but tied together with humor, smarts, and audacity. Valentine and mad genius producer Deja were convinced down to the giant flying bat on Brooke’s half-shirt that female-helmed R& B could be every bit as bizarre and crazy as rap by the likes of Outkast and Ol’ Dirty Bastard , and they were damned well going to prove it.
